What does CoDrone EDU Refer To?
This educational drone teaches coding and STEM ideas. It is easy to use, small and features tools to make learning entertaining and engaging. With this drone, the user can program flight paths, solve problems, and grasp drone technology. Among its main characteristics are:
Blockly is used for Block-based coding; Python is used for text-based coding.
Sturdy but light frame.
Designed primarily to impart ideas from aerodynamics, engineering, and computational thinking.

How does CoDrone EDU Enhance Coding Abilities?
In this technologically advanced environment, coding is among the most crucial abilities of today. Tools for STEM education help students acquire relevant programming knowledge. Using drag-and-drop languages or more sophisticated ones like Python, students could hone their flight patterns and tackle challenging tasks. Think about these instances:
Work through obstacle courses.
Execute aerial flips or spins.
Land strictly at specified locations.
